Description GPT Law is an AI tool designed to simplify complex legal information, enabling users to quickly understand laws, court cases, and legal documents. It offers instant summaries, legal Q&A, and facilitates legal research and document drafting. Reggie is an AI language tutor designed to improve speaking fluency. It facilitates speech-focused, real-world conversations, offering interactive practice and instant feedback to enhance users' speaking skills.
What It Does Processes legal texts to provide instant summaries, explanations of laws and court cases, answers legal questions, and assists in drafting legal documents. This tool provides AI-powered conversational practice, enabling users to speak a new language naturally and receive immediate feedback on pronunciation and grammar.
